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Slab: Larger slabs require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Thickness of the Slab: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ive due to the additional concrete required.
- Site Preparation: Costs can vary based on the need for grading, excavation, and clearing of the site.
- Concrete Quality: Higher-grade concrete can enhance durability but comes at a higher price.
- Reinforcement: Adding rebar or mesh for strength increases cost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Lake Charles, LA can significantly impact the total c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Fees for required permits and inspections add to the overall expense.
- Additional Features: Features like drainage systems, finishes, or coatings can increase cost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Lake Charles, LA)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$500 - $1,500 |
Concrete (per cubic yard) | $100 - $150 |
Labor (per hour) | $50 - $75 |
Reinforcement (rebar/mesh) | $0.50 - $1.00 per sq ft |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$500 |
Finishing and Coating | $2 - $5 per sq ft |
Total Installation | $3,000 - $7,000 |
